How to Make Cranberry & Spinach Stuffed Chicken with Brie
Now that we have our ingredients ready, let’s dive into the steps for making this delightful Cranberry & Spinach Stuffed Chicken with Brie. Each step is simple, and I promise you’ll feel like a pro in the kitchen!
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
First things first, pre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Preheating is crucial because it ensures that the chicken cooks evenly. No one wants dry chicken, right? This temperature is perfect for getting that juicy, tender chicken while allowing the stuffing to melt beautifully.
Step 2: Prepare the Filling
In a mixing bowl, combine the chopped spinach, dried cranberries, and brie cheese. Use a fork to mix everything together until well combined. The spinach should be evenly distributed, and the brie should be broken into small pieces. This mixture is where the magic happens, so make sure it’s mixed well!
Step 3: Stuff the Chicken
Next, take each chicken breast and carefully cut a pocket into the side. Be gentle; you don’t want to slice all the way through. Once you have your pocket, generously stuff it with the spinach mixture. Don’t be shy—pack it in there! This is what makes the chicken so flavorful and satisfying.
Step 4: Season the Chicken
Now it’s time to season the outside of the chicken. Drizzle a little olive oil over each breast, then sprinkle with garlic powder, salt, pepper, and dried thyme. This seasoning is essential for enhancing the flavor of the chicken. Rub it in gently to ensure every bite is bursting with taste.
Step 5: Bake the Chicken
Place the stuffed chicken breasts in a baking dish, making sure they’re not crowded. Bake them in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es. To check for doneness, use a meat thermometer; the internal temperature should reach 165°F (75°C). The juices should run clear, signaling that your chicken is perfectly cooked.
Step 6: Rest and Serve
Once the chicken is done, let it rest for about 5 minutes before serving. This resting period allows the juices to redistribute, keeping the chicken moist and flavorful. After resting, slice it open to reveal that gorgeous stuffing, and get ready to impress your family!

PrintCranberry & Spinach Stuffed Chicken with Brie: A Delight!
A delicious and elegant dish featuring chicken breasts stuffed with a savory mixture of spinach, cranberries, and creamy brie cheese.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 30 minutes
- Total Time: 45 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Category: Main Course
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Gluten Free
Ingredients
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 1 cup fresh spinach, chopped
- 1/2 cup dried cranberries, chopped
- 1 cup brie cheese, rind removed and chopped
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1/2 teaspoon dried thyme
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
- In a bowl, mix together the spinach, cranberries, and brie cheese.
- Cut a pocket in each chicken breast and stuff with the spinach mixture.
- Season the outside of the chicken with olive oil, garlic powder, salt, pepper, and thyme.
- Place the stuffed chicken breasts in a baking dish.
- Bake for 25-30 minutes or until the chicken is cooked through and juices run clear.
- Let rest for 5 minutes before serving.
Notes
- For added flavor, marinate the chicken in olive oil and herbs for a few hours before stuffing.
- Serve with a side of roasted vegetables or a fresh salad.
- Leftovers can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
